What are petroleum engineering students?

Petroleum engineering students are individuals who are studying the principles and practices involved in extracting oil and gas from underground reservoirs. They typically pursue a bachelor's degree in petroleum engineering or a related field, learning about geology, drilling techniques, reservoir management, and production operations. These students often participate in internships or research projects to gain practical experience and prepare for careers in the energy industry. Upon graduation, they may work as petroleum engineers, field engineers, or in other roles related to oil and gas exploration and production.

What are the key skills and qualifications needed to thrive as a Petroleum Engineering Student, and why are they important?

To thrive as a Petroleum Engineering Student, you need a solid grasp of mathematics, physics, and chemistry, along with enrollment in an accredited petroleum engineering or related engineering program. Familiarity with industry-standard software such as MATLAB, Petrel, and reservoir simulation tools is commonly expected. Strong analytical thinking, problem-solving abilities, and effective teamwork skills help students excel in both academic and practical settings. These competencies are crucial for mastering complex engineering concepts, succeeding in internships, and preparing for a successful transition into the petroleum industry.

What types of hands-on experiences or projects can a Petroleum Engineering student expect during their studies?

As a Petroleum Engineering student, you can expect to participate in a variety of hands-on experiences such as laboratory experiments, field trips to drilling sites, and collaborative design projects. Many programs also offer internships with oil and gas companies, where students work alongside industry professionals and gain practical exposure to drilling, reservoir management, and production operations. These experiences are designed to bridge the gap between theoretical knowledge and real-world application, preparing you for the technical and teamwork challenges common in the petroleum industry.

How much does a first year petroleum engineer make?

A first-year petroleum engineer typically earns between $70,000 and $90,000 annually, depending on location, company, and educational background. Entry-level salaries may also include benefits such as bonuses and health insurance, and the role often requires knowledge of industry-specific tools like drilling software.

General Notes
This is a temporary training position that may be renewed annually, for a maximum of five years, based upon performance review, progress towards research goals, and continuation of funding.
Purpose
The Postdoctoral Fellow will conduct world-leading research, producing deliverables on time, keeping projects within budget, meeting project reporting and publication requirements, and ensuring that the project is appropriately resourced.
Responsibilities
  • Conducts state-of-the-art drilling research in the areas of hydraulics and multi-phase flow dynamics, managed pressure drilling, drill string dynamics, geothermal well construction
  • Works on proposals, R&D plans, schedules, and completion of reports on detailed phase of research projects
  • Supervision of undergraduate and graduate students and staff associated with R&D projects
  • Write papers and present results at relevant professional meetings and conferences
  • Provides input on research and development inquiries, insight and direction for testing procedures and research
  • Performs other related duties as assigned

Required Qualifications
Ph.D. degree in Mechanical / Petroleum Engineering received within three years of the start date. Background in computational science and multi-physics modeling, including computational fluid dynamics (CFD) and multibody dynamics. Strong experience of scientific computational software development including proven programming experience in multiple programming languages including Python and Matlab. Strong proven record of peer-reviewed publications in the aforementioned areas. Prior experience with supervision.
Preferred Qualifications
Research background in modeling of multiphase flow in pipe and porous media coupled with heat transfer. Research background in drill string dynamics, preferably using the multibody dynamics method. Familiar with drilling and well-completion technologies. Understanding of drilling tools and practices in the field. Experience in software secondary development (development of user interfaces, etc.). Successful experience in patent application. Previous experience with project supervision.
